Crew Member Discloses Mental Health Struggle After ‘Tsunami of Harassment Post-Spaceflight

Astronaut during mission
The scientist and activist, a bioastronautics research scientist, was onboard the New Shepard NS-31 rocket in April 2025.

A Vietnamese-American astronaut has publicly detailed her battle with depression after facing a “tsunami of harassment” in the wake of a pioneering women-only spaceflight.

The 34-year-old activist – celebrated as a researcher and activist – was part of the 11-minute suborbital flight in April, which also included high-profile passengers.

The high-profile flight was widely scrutinized by some, who challenged its value and carbon footprint.

Reflecting on the experience, the astronaut, who was celebrated as the first Vietnamese woman in space, stated the vicious response eclipsed her moment under an “avalanche of misogyny”.

“I told her my depression might last for years,” Ms. Nguyen stated in a online statement, recalling a phone call from a mission companion in the period after the journey.

She characterized the press attention and digital reaction as an “onslaught no human brain has evolved to endure”.

“Stuck in Texas, I spent a week unable to rise from my bed,” she revealed. “A month later… I had to hang up… because I could not speak through my tears.”

Eclipsed by Backlash

The researcher, who has conducted studies in women's health research and performed experiments during the mission, said everything she had worked for – from her studies and extensive preparation to the symbolic importance of her roots – was buried under the deluge of misogyny.

She is best known for her tireless campaigning championing the cause of survivors of assault.

Her own aspiration for spaceflight was paused after an attack during her university years, leading to a years-long quest for justice.

Finding Solid Ground

In the time since reaching space, she reports that the heaviest sorrow is beginning to clear, and she thanked the followers whose kindness pulled her through. “Your support rescued me,” she affirmed.

She added that amid the criticism, significant positive outcomes had come out of the experience, such as elevated attention for her women's health research and chances to influence leaders.
